12233 NW 7th Ave, Miami, FL 33168
16600 NW 57th Ave Unit 4, Miami Lakes, FL 33014
7801 NW 32nd St, Doral, FL 33122
3305 NW 79th Ave, Doral, FL 33122
3305 NW 79th Ave, Miami, FL 33122
3305 NW 79th Ave, Miami, FL 33122
1130 Opa-Locka Blvd, Miami, FL 33168
1726 NW 36th St Unit 3, Miami, FL 33142
2385 NW 70th Ave Suite A10, Miami, FL 33122
8369 NW 36th St, Doral, FL 33166
Calls to the listed contractor will be routed directly to their business. Calls to any general helpline will be answered or returned by one of the contractors featured on this site. By calling the helpline, you agree to the terms of use. We do not receive any commission or fee based on which contractor you choose. There is no obligation to proceed with services.